Job Purpose

Intercontinental Exchange (ICE) is seeking a Lead Developer - Front-End Web Development, responsible for building and supporting large-scale enterprise applications that integrate with back-end systems using RESTful web services and JavaScript APIs. The ideal candidate will have deep expertise in JavaScript, CSS, and HTML, along with modern frameworks and tools such as React, Redux, ExtJS, TypeScript and Node.js (npm). At Intercontinental Exchange, you will work at the forefront of global finance with state-of-the-art technology that directly influences essential markets worldwide.

Responsibilities

  • Contribute to the design and development of company-wide web applications and libraries.
  • Lead efforts to design, architect, and implement new software components.
  • Independently manage project activities related to builds and deployments.
  • Create and maintain software tests to ensure functionality and quality.
  • Develop design documentation for new software and subsequent versions.
  • Identify opportunities to improve and optimize applications.
  • Collaborate with business analysts or product managers to understand new requirements.
  • Support and mentor developers on JavaScript/web concepts.
  • Adhere to team guidelines for quality and consistency.
  • Follow company software development processes and standards.

Knowledge and Experience

  • Bachelor's degree in computer science; graduate degree preferred.
  • 5+ years of advanced JavaScript and functional programming experience.
  • 3+ years of advanced CSS experience.
  • 2+ years of HTML5 techniques.
  • Experience with at least one modern JavaScript framework (e.g., React, Redux, ExtJS).
  • Experience building applications with TypeScript.
  • Experience with iterative/test-driven development, code refactoring, and continuous integration.
  • Experience with client-side testing tools (e.g., React Testing Library, Jest).
  • Strong understanding of browser quirks and cross-browser optimization.
  • Passion, discretion, analytical thinking, and independent judgment are key to success in this role.
  • Passion for learning new technologies and adapting to fast-paced environments.

Preferred Knowledge and Experience

  • Modern JavaScript language features (ES6+)
  • CSS-in-JS (e.g., Emotion), Tailwind, LESS, or SASS
  • RESTful design concepts and JSON-pure APIs
  • Babel.js
  • Git
  • Electron
  • Experience with AI-powered development tools including Claude Code and Cursor for accelerated code generation and refactoring
  • Knowledge of RAG / MCP / LLM technologies
  • Strong problem-solving abilities, with proven performance tuning, debugging, and memory profiling expertise (JavaScript and/or Java)
  • Back-end experience with Java and Spring Boot; a passion for financial markets; or open-source contributions
